前言

由于要组团的合作开发软件所以就必须要用到一个新的软件开发工具那就是SVN,其实就是一个管理项目的软件下面就简单给大家介绍一下这款软件的安装过程

正文

下载后,运行 VisualSvn-Server-2.1.4.msi 程序,点击Next,下面的截图顺序即为安装步骤:

【步骤1】安装首界面,见图2-2-1。

SVN安装和使用_服务器

图2-2-1安装首界面

【步骤2】选择组件为服务器和管理终端功能 见图2-2-2。

SVN安装和使用_svn_02

图2-2-2选择组件为服务器和管理终端功能

【步骤3】自定义安装配置 见图2-2-3。

SVN安装和使用_服务器_03

图2-2-3自定义安装配置

【注意】:

如果不选择Use secure connection ,Server Port那里,默认端口有80/81/8080三个;如果选中最后面的CheckBox,则表示使用安全连接【https协议】,这是的端口只有433/8433二个可用。 默认是选用的。

至于授权Authentication,默认选择 VisualSVN Server自带的用户和用户组

【步骤4】 点击安装按钮,进行安装 见图2-2-4。

SVN安装和使用_代码库_04

【步骤5】安装成功,服务启动,见图2-3-5。

SVN安装和使用_svn_05

图2-3-5 安装成功

2.3 VisualSvn Server 配置与使用方法

安装好VisualSVN Server后【安装过程看2.2节】,运行VisualSVN Server Manger,下面是启动界面,见图2-3-1:

SVN安装和使用_服务器_06

图2-3-1 VisualSVN Server 启动界面

2.3.1添加代码库StartKit

下面添加一个代码库Repository 叫StartKit,并进行相关设置:

【步骤1】创建代码库StartKit,见图2-3-2。

SVN安装和使用_代码库_07

图2-3-2创建代码库StartKit

【步骤2】代码库基本配置,见图2-3-3,创建新的代码库,在下图所示的文本框中输入代码库名称:

SVN安装和使用_服务器_08

图2-3-3代码库基本配置

【注意】

Repository URL 地址是用来从客户端或者VS2008中连接服务器。机器名可以改成IP,这里用的安全连接模式https。

上图中的代码库文件结构CheckBox如果选中,则在代码库StartKit下面会创建trunk、branches、tags三个子目录;不选中,则只创建空的代码库StartKit。默认不选中

点击OK按钮,代码库就创建成功了,见图2-3-4。

SVN安装和使用_服务器_09

图2-3-4 代码创建成功

2.3.2 代码库安全性设置 用户和用户组

下面,我们开始安全性设置,在左侧的Users上点击右键:

【步骤1】创建用户。

创建用户,并设置用户名和密码,见图2-3-5,图2-3-6。

SVN安装和使用_代码库_10

图2-3-5 创建用户

SVN安装和使用_svn_11

图2-3-6 用户名和密码设置

输入上面的信息,点击OK,我们就创建一个用户了。按照上面的过程,分别添加用户startKiter1、startKiter2、startKiter3。

【步骤2】添加这些用户到我们刚才创建的项目里。

右击代码库StartKit的属性见图2-3-7,弹出属性对话框见图2-3-8。

SVN安装和使用_服务器_12

图2-3-7 代码库的属性菜单

SVN安装和使用_svn_13

图2-3-8 给用户分配权限

点击上图中的"Add…"按钮,在下图中选择我们刚才添加的用户,点击OK按钮:

【注意】

大家可能注意到了下图中的Groups,是的,你也可以先创建组,把用户添加到各个组中,然后对组进行授权,操作比较简单,在此略过。

【步骤3】创建组,并选择该组的用户,见图2-3-9。

SVN安装和使用_代码库_14

图2-3-9 给组划分

用户

结尾

本文大部分是参考vs2010软件配置管理说明来写的,软件版本上可能有点出入,不过大体的过程还是很有参考价值的.